Transaction 81b570068ee81b81ab00ade60646910ff7886734833543777c826aba1b4302a3
1 Input
1 Output
-
81b570068ee81b81ab00ade60646910ff7886734833543777c826aba1b4302a3:0
- value
- 2044296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eab6794b70af3e472ec29d3cebcae0f2495ab905 OP_EQUAL
- address
- 3P64dw9qSW6hV1tZgegq93tnB1MseGXaQu